PTT Synergy buys land for RM36mil


KUALA LUMPUR: PTT Synergy Group’s wholly-owned subsidiary, PTT Logistics Hub 1 Sdn Bhd (PTTL H1) has proposed to acquire two parcels of freehold land in Gombak, Selangor for RM36mil cash.

In a filing with Bursa Malaysia, PTT Synergy said PTTL H1 entered a sale and purchase agreement (SPA) with Koperasi Kakitangan Bank Rakyat Bhd (Sekatarakyat) for the proposed acquisition.

PTTL H1 will acquire two parcels of land with sizes of 11,295 sq m and 15,042 sq m, respectively, for RM15.4mil and RM20.56mil.

PTT Synergy said the purchase consideration will be satisfied in cash, funded by a combination of internally generated funds and bank borrowings.

“The proposed acquisition provides an investment opportunity for the group to develop a commercial warehouse in which its storage and retrieval systems are fully automated. This is part of the group’s strategy to continuously provide comprehensive solutions for warehousing and distribution centres, with a strong emphasis on total intralogistics solutions,” it said
